To solve the equation 6X + 29 = 5, we need to isolate the variable "X".

Step 1: Subtract 29 from both sides of the equation to get rid of the constant term on the left side:
6X + 29 - 29 = 5 - 29
6X = -24

Step 2: Divide both sides of the equation by 6 to solve for X:
6X/6 = -24/6
X = -4

Therefore, the solution to the equation 6X + 29 = 5 is X = -4.
